Food Scene
The United States has a rich and diverse food scene, with each region offering its own unique c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include pizza in New York, barbecue in Texas, seafood in New England, and Mexican food in California. Don’t forget to try regional specialties like lobster rolls in Maine, hot chicken in Nashville, and gumbo in Louisiana.

Historical Landmarks
The United States has a rich history, and there are many historical landmarks to explore. Some of the most popular include the Liberty Bell in Philadelphia, the Alamo in San Antonio, and Independence Hall in Philadelphia. Don’t forget to visit the many Civil War battlefields and presidential homes around the country.

Local Markets
Exploring local markets is a great way to get a taste of the local culture and support local businesses. Some of the best markets include the Pike Place Market in Seattle, the Ferry Building Marketplace in San Francisco, and the Reading Terminal Market in Philadelphia.

Biking Routes
The United States has many scenic biking routes, from the California coastline to the Colorado Rockies. Some of the best routes include the Katy Trail in Missouri, the Virginia Creeper Trail in Virginia, and the Pacific Coast Highway in California.
Wellness Retreats
The United States has many wellness retreats that offer yoga, meditation, and other relaxation activities. Some of the best retreats include the Esalen Institute in California, the Kripalu Center for Yoga and Health in Massachusetts, and the Omega Institute in New York.
